2. Important Areas of Work Legislation
Discrimination
Employment discrimination occurs when an employee is treated unfairly based on protected characteristics such as race, gender, age, faith, or disability. An employment legal professional may help victims of discrimination file issues and go after authorized action against their businesses.

Retaliation
Retaliation takes place when an employer can take adverse motion from an personnel for asserting their rights, which include filing a complaint or taking part in an investigation. Employment Lawyers can help in proving retaliation promises and securing justice for influenced workers.

Sexual Harassment
Sexual harassment in the office can manifest as unwanted innovations, inappropriate responses, or perhaps a hostile do the job setting. Work attorneys deliver authorized advice and representation for victims seeking to hold their businesses accountable.

Loved ones and Professional medical Leave Act (FMLA)
The FMLA presents eligible staff members with the proper to consider unpaid depart for unique family members and clinical factors. If an employer denies FMLA legal rights or retaliates versus an personnel for using leave, an work lawyer will help pursue promises to safeguard All those rights.

Uniformed Providers Employment and Reemployment Legal rights Act (USERRA)
USERRA safeguards the work legal rights of provider associates and veterans. Employment Lawyers aid persons in navigating USERRA statements, making employment attorney certain These are reinstated of their positions without having discrimination.

Whistleblower Protections
Whistleblower regulations secure personnel who report unlawful or unethical practices in their organization. Employment attorneys can guideline whistleblowers by means of the whole process of reporting misconduct whilst safeguarding their rights.

Time beyond regulation Pay
Under the Good Labor Benchmarks Act (FLSA), workers are entitled to time beyond regulation purchase hrs labored further than the regular 40-hour workweek. Employment attorneys might help staff Recuperate unpaid extra time wages and make certain compliance with labor legislation.

Wrongful Termination
Wrongful termination refers back to the unlawful firing of an employee in violation of work legislation or contracts. Employment attorneys look into statements of wrongful termination and aid consumers in pursuing authorized therapies.
